# self **Repository Path**: heppen/self ## Basic Information - **Project Name**: self - **Description**: No description available - **Primary Language**: Unknown - **License**: Not specified - **Default Branch**: master - **Homepage**: None - **GVP Project**: No ## Statistics - **Stars**: 0 - **Forks**: 5 - **Created**: 2022-11-24 - **Last Updated**: 2023-04-15 ## Categories & Tags **Categories**: Uncategorized **Tags**: None ## README # openEuler 分布式软总线客户端 demo 说明:这个代码仓是 openEuler 下分布式软总线客户端的 demo 程序,如果想使用软总线的功能,需要自己编写客户端程序和软总线服务端进行通信。本代码仓由[self](https://gitee.com/beilingxie/self) fork出来。 ## 文件结构 ```txt ├── devicemanager │   └── devicemanager -> 认证相关的devicemanager可执行软件 ├── hichain │   ├── build.sh -> openEuler下编译hichain的脚本 │   ├── hichain_main -> openEuler下可执行的hichain客户端软件 │   ├── hichain_main.c -> hichain客户端源代码 │   ├── hichain_main_OH -> OpenHarmony下可执行的hichain客户端软件 │   └── parameter.h -> 编译依赖的头文件 ├── README.md └── softbus_sample -> 软总线客户端demo源码目录 ├── build.sh -> 编译软总线客户端的脚本 ├── include -> 软总线的一些头文件,编译客户端程序需要 ├── softbus_client_main.c -> 软总线客户端源代码 └── softbus_trans_permission.json -> OpenHarmony下给客户端添加权限的配置文件 ``` ## 参考 * [openEuler嵌入式分布式软总线说明文档](https://openeuler.gitee.io/yocto-meta-openeuler/master/features/distributed_softbus.html):可了解 openEuler 下分布式软总线的使用,以及使用 hichain/device manager 进行认证说明。 * [基于分布式软总线扩展生态互联](https://docs.openeuler.org/zh/docs/22.03_LTS_SP1/docs/Distributed/%E5%9F%BA%E4%BA%8E%E5%88%86%E5%B8%83%E5%BC%8F%E8%BD%AF%E6%80%BB%E7%BA%BF%E6%89%A9%E5%B1%95%E7%94%9F%E6%80%81%E4%BA%92%E8%81%94.html): openEuler 官方文档里软总线的说明,有 OpenHarmony 下编写分布式软总线客户端的例子说明。